We have yet another addition to this little corner of the internet – Unite 2010. Some of you may remember an earlier post about the Unity3D engine – what it was and what it does. Well, within the next three weeks the Unite 2010 conference is being held in Montreal, Canada.

I suppose I should explain; Unite is a rather new but nevertheless successful endeavor by the developers of Unity3D that aims to bring the ever-growing community of Unity Developers, small and big name companies, and the general Unity community together to share, discuss and network. They also occasionally make surprise announcements such as the mention of the now-released Unity 3.0 from Unite 2009 last year. Some of the companies that make an appearance are triple A giants such as EA and publishers like Activision; so as you can tell Unity is causing quite a stir of interest in the gaming world.
